Transaction 2359edd0dce3956482786f4bcee367458df862c53ff10234f807ee6c35ddf899
1 Input
1 Output
-
2359edd0dce3956482786f4bcee367458df862c53ff10234f807ee6c35ddf899:0
- value
- 28387
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fbaf3fa5e165a2cb66f9cb70eae57ce5d70cd75 OP_EQUAL
- address
- 3N5za3fk3azd9FrstPrr1kHiZ7Gjiq6sM5